From Pallet Jacks to AGVs: Modern Material Transport
Traditionally, material handling within distribution centers relied heavily on physical equipment like pallet jacks and forklifts. While these machines remain prevalent, a significant transition is underway, driven by the need for increased productivity, reduced workforce costs, and improved security. This transformation is marked by the growing adoption of Automated Guided Vehicles (AGVs). AGVs, ranging from simple tuggers to complex autonomous forklifts, utilize various guidance technologies – including wire guidance, laser guidance, and vision guidance – to navigate facilities without direct human direction. The merits are considerable: AGVs can operate 24/7, reducing bottlenecks and improving material flow. Furthermore, they minimize the risk of collisions and worker injury. Forklift & Pallet Truck Safety & Best Practices
Maintaining a secure work environment when operating forklifts and pallet trucks is paramount. Regular examinations of all equipment are essential before each use, focusing on brakes, direction, forks, and rubber. Operators must be adequately trained and certified to operate the specific type of equipment, understanding load limits and stability principles. When moving loads, always keep them low to the floor Automation & AGVs and balanced, avoiding sudden pauses or sharp manoeuvres. Pedestrians should always be aware of forklift traffic and maintain a safe distance. Establishing clear walkways and designated pedestrian areas can significantly reduce the risk of accidents. Accurate stacking of pallets is key – pallets should be stable, well-secured, and not overloaded. Remember to always use the horn to alert others of your presence, especially at intersections and blind spots. Finally, encourage a safety-first culture where reporting near misses and hazards is encouraged and acted upon quickly.

Counterbalanced Forklifts & Reach Trucks: Choosing the Correct Equipmen
Selecting the suitable material handling equipment is essential for productive warehouse operations. Both counterbalanced forklifts and reach trucks are robust machines, but they excel in varying applications. Counterbalanced forklifts offer adaptability, handling a extensive range of loads and operating in varied spaces. They are suited for loading/unloading vehicles, moving materials over greater distances, and overall warehouse tasks. However, they require larger aisles for maneuvering. Reach trucks, on the other hand, are engineered for confined aisle operation. Their ability to lift loads high and operate in compact spaces makes them excellent for high-density storage environments. When choosing, consider your warehouse layout, load weights, lifting heights, and the amount of travel. A comprehensive analysis will ensure you select the equipment that improves productivity and lowers operational costs. Don't neglect factors like operator expertise and maintenance requirements – these are equally important as the initial purchase.
